the paralle bases of a trapezoid measure 2 feet and 6 feet. if the legs measure 9 feet and 13 feet, determine the perimeter of the trapezoid

∴The perimeter of the trapezoid= 30 feet

Explanation:

Given that the parallel bases of a trapezoid measure 2 feet and 6 feet and the legs measured 9 feet and 13 feet.

∴The perimeter of the trapezoid = sum of all sides

= (2+6+9+13) feet

= 30 feet
